Abstract
This invention relates to personal computers, and more particularly to the provision of shielding for attenuating the emission of electromagnetic radiation and the like from an enclosure for such computers. A personal computer in accordance with this invention has a chassis for mounting a planar board and having a base, a front panel, and a rear panel. The front panel defines at least one bay for receiving a data storage device. In order to attenuate the emission of electromagnetic radiation through the windows formed for the bays in the front panel of the chassis, this invention contemplates that at least one manually removable shield member will be mounted in any bay.
